Output 0ddd89120ff7b4a7e4fa9947f3abda4b38404d419e2f308e8de60dfcd1d7a860:3

value
5405689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565ee933846c7f00d2b840a68381cd60c2b7b0f2 OP_EQUAL
address
39ZhjZxYr2K7eFMCoBF7NFN8QqZFnGs4ty
transaction
0ddd89120ff7b4a7e4fa9947f3abda4b38404d419e2f308e8de60dfcd1d7a860
confirmations
370203
spent
true